Wolleg 10 Geschrieben 27. Oktober 2004 Melden Teilen Geschrieben 27. Oktober 2004 Hallo, ich hoffe mir kann jemand helfen! Ich habe eine Accessdatenbank erstellt und in dieser über ODBC Tabellen aus unserer Oracledatenbank verknüpft. Aus diesen verknüpften Tabellen liest Access verschiedene Daten in seine eigenen Tabellen. Mit diesen Daten kann ich dann arbeiten ohne in Oracle was zu verändern. Nun habe ich das Problem das wenn sich in Oracle was ändert die Access Tabelle diese neuen Datensätze nicht automatisch übernimmt. Kann man einstellen das Access sich Intervallmäßig mit der Oracle abgleicht? Wenn ja, wie? Mfg Wolleg Zitieren Link zu diesem Kommentar
Tim84 10 Geschrieben 29. Oktober 2004 Melden Teilen Geschrieben 29. Oktober 2004 Hallo Wolleg, also in der Art wie du dir das vorstellst glaube ich ist das nicht möglich. Zitat: Aus diesen verknüpften Tabellen liest Access verschiedene Daten in seine eigenen Tabelle Soweit ich das verstehe arbeitest du eigentlich auf Accesstabellen die immer wieder mit den neusten Daten aus Oracle gefüllt werden. Um zu erreichen das du immer auf dem aktuellsten Daten arbeitest müsstest du direkt auf die ODBC Verknüpfungen gehen und nicht auf die Access Tabellen. Gruß Tim Zitieren Link zu diesem Kommentar
old_di 10 Geschrieben 29. Oktober 2004 Melden Teilen Geschrieben 29. Oktober 2004 ich hab dich eigentlich so verstanden, das du die tabellen verknüpft hast. siehst du im access an diesem kleinen symbol. sieht aus wie ne weltkugel mit einem pfeil. verknüpfte tabellen sollten eigentlich immer den aktuellen stand anzeigen. importiert natürlich nicht. wenn sie das nicht tun... hier noch ne frage: arbeitest du direkt in den tabellen, hast du mal die menüfunktion datensätze=> filter entfernen probiert (auch wenn keiner gesetzt ist, wird die tabelle neu gelesen) ansosnsten bleibt eventuell noch eine einstellung am odbc treiber. Zitieren Link zu diesem Kommentar
Wolleg 10 Geschrieben 29. Oktober 2004 Autor Melden Teilen Geschrieben 29. Oktober 2004 @Tim84 ich kann auf keinen Fall in den verknüpften Tabellen arbeiten, das wäre ja direkt die Oracle. Da darf ich nichts ändern! @old-di sie sind verknüpft und da sind natürlich immer die aktuellen Daten drin. Ich arbeite in den Access Tabellen die wiederum mit Datensätzen aus den verknüpften Oracle gefüllt werden. Nur füllt er die Accesstabellen nur einmal. Ich möchte aber da er z.B. alle 10 minuten seine Tabelle mit den verknüpften abgleicht! Im odbc habe ich sowas nicht gefunden! Gruß Wolleg Zitieren Link zu diesem Kommentar
old_di 10 Geschrieben 29. Oktober 2004 Melden Teilen Geschrieben 29. Oktober 2004 .. dann führst du also jedesmal eine einfügeabfrage oder so aus? oder wie kommen die daten in die accesstabellen? wenn das so ist, dann schreib ein kleines vbscript, welches nach 10 minuten ausgeführt wird und die acces tabelle aktualisiert. das müßtest du in einem formular machen. wenn du in einer tabellenähnlichen ansicht arbeiten willst, mußt du nur die entsprechende formularansicht wählen. Zitieren Link zu diesem Kommentar
Empfohlene Beiträge
Schreibe einen Kommentar
Du kannst jetzt antworten und Dich später registrieren. Falls Du bereits ein Mitglied bist, logge Dich jetzt ein.